The Rattlecopter (9443-1) is a LEGO Ninjago set that was released in November 2011 and retired in December 2012 with a shelf life of 1 year and 1 month 2 days.
This LEGO set has 327 pieces and had a RRP of $29.99 (£24.99 / -) which equates to a price per piece of 0.09c (0.08p / 0.00€). Since it retired it has grown in value by 294.1% and now has a value of $118.18 based on average sale price over the last 6 months.
This set contains 3 minifigures with a combined value of $34.75. 1 of the minifigures in this set are exclusive, meaning they don't appear in any other LEGO sets.
